Welcome to a delightful culinary experience with our Zesty Lemon White Bean Orzo Soup! This vibrant soup is the epitome of comfort and zest, perfect for those days when you need a bowl of warmth and nourishment. Infused with bright flavors and textures, it is a celebration of creamy white beans paired with tender orzo, topped off with a refreshing lemon zest that tantalizes your taste buds. Quick to assemble with only one pot, this recipe embodies simplicity and convenience — making it a weeknight favorite. Its heartwarming aroma not only fills your home but also promises wholesome nutrition, capturing the essence of cozy dining. Whether you’re a seasoned cook or just beginning your culinary journey, this soup offers both ease and sophistication. Keep reading to understand why this dish must be your next kitchen endeavor!
Why You’ll Love This Zesty Lemon White Bean Orzo Soup
This soup is as delightful to the senses as it is beneficial to your health. Here’s why:
- One-pot Wonder: Minimal cleanup and maximum flavor with everything cooked in a single pot.
- Nutrient-packed: Loaded with protein-rich white beans and nutritious vegetables.
- Vegan-friendly: Use coconut milk for a creamy, dairy-free option.
- Zesty and Spicy: The perfect balance of lemon tang and optional red pepper heat.
Preparation Phase & Tools to Use
Preparing your kitchen workspace efficiently is key to enjoying a seamless cooking experience. Begin by gathering all your ingredients and kitchen tools to streamline the process. You will need a large pot or Dutch oven — this is where the magic happens. Ensure your chopping board is sturdy as you finely chop the onion, carrots, and celery. A sharp knife is essential for precision and speed. Also, secure a can opener for the cannellini beans and a zester for the fresh lemon zest. Having a wooden spoon ready will facilitate stirring without damaging your cookware, and don’t forget a measuring cup for the orzo pasta. If you’re using fresh herbs, consider having kitchen twine handy to bundle the rosemary for easy removal later. Once your kitchen is ready, you’ll sail through the cooking process seamlessly!

Ingredients
- 1 can cannellini beans, rinsed and drained
- ¾ cup dry orzo pasta
- 1 small onion, finely chopped
- 2 small carrots, chopped
- 2 celery stalks, diced
- 6 garlic cloves, minced
- 5 cups low-sodium vegetable broth
- 2 tbsp coconut milk or vegan butter
- Juice and zest of 1 lemon
- 1 tsp dried thyme
- ½ tsp Italian seasoning
- ½ tsp red pepper flakes (optional)
- 2 bay leaves
- 1 sprig fresh rosemary (or ½ tsp dried)
- 1 tsp olive oil
- Salt and pepper, to taste
- ¼ cup fresh parsley, chopped (for garnish)
Instructions
Step 1: Sauté Your Vegetables
In your pot, warm up the olive oil over medium heat. Introduce the finely chopped onion, diced carrots, and celery with just a sprinkle of salt to enhance their natural flavors. Let these vegetables sauté for about 5 to 7 minutes, stirring occasionally, until they become soft and slightly translucent.
Step 2: Infuse with Garlic & Spices
Add the minced garlic into the pot, stirring quickly to prevent burning. As it begins to release its aroma (around 1 minute), incorporate the dried thyme, Italian seasoning, and, if using, the red pepper flakes. This blend will form the aromatic base of your soup.
Step 3: Combine Beans & Creaminess
Next, stir in the drained cannellini beans followed by your choice of coconut milk or vegan butter. This step coats the beans, integrating them with the seasoned vegetables – setting the stage for the soup’s rich yet subtle texture.
Step 4: Simmer the Broth
Pour in the vegetable broth, ensuring the beans are submerged. Add the bay leaves and fresh rosemary, then bring your mixture to a rolling boil. Once boiling, reduce the heat and let it simmer for about 10 minutes, giving the flavors time to meld together.
Step 5: Cook the Orzo
Carefully add the orzo to your soup, stirring occasionally to prevent sticking. Allow it to simmer for another 10 to 12 minutes, until the orzo is al dente yet tender. Be mindful to keep an eye on it, stirring occasionally.
Step 6: Finishing Touches with Lemon
Turn off the heat and stir in the lemon juice and zest. This brightens the dish, adding that sought-after zing. Adjust with salt and pepper to suit your taste. Remember to fish out the bay leaves and rosemary before serving.
Step 7: Serve and Garnish
Serve your soup hot, ladeling it into bowls and garnishing generously with fresh parsley for a pop of color and extra freshness. Delight in every vibrant, aromatic spoonful!

Variations
- Protein: For added protein, consider including cooked shredded chicken or chickpeas.
- Vegetables: Enhance your soup with kale, spinach, or zucchini to amp up the nutritional content.
- Spices: Experiment with fresh basil or oregano for a different herbal note.
Cooking Notes
- Opt for high-quality vegetable broth to enhance the soup’s depth of flavor.
- If storing leftovers, you may need to add extra broth when reheating as the orzo tends to absorb liquid over time.
Serving Suggestions
- Pair the soup with crusty bread or garlic toast for a complete meal.
- Serve with a side salad for added freshness and nutrition.
Tips
- Be careful when adding salt since the broth might already contain some.
- Consider lemon zest to enhance citrus notes without altering the liquid ratio.
Prep Time, Cook Time, Total Time
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Total Time: 40 minutes
Nutritional Information
- Calories: Approximately 220 per serving
- Protein: 9g
- Sodium: 400mg
FAQs
Can I use a different type of pasta?
Yes, small pasta shapes like ditalini or small shells will work just as well.
Is there a gluten-free version?
Switch the orzo for a gluten-free pasta or even rice.
How long will leftovers last?
This soup can be refrigerated for up to 3 days in an airtight container.
Can I freeze this soup?
Yes, but consider undercooking the orzo slightly before freezing to avoid mushiness upon reheating.
Conclusion
This Zesty Lemon White Bean Orzo Soup is more than just a meal — it’s an experience packed with warmth, flavor, and health benefits. Its fresh ingredients and simple preparation offer a comforting, hearty dish that’s sure to become a staple in your meal rotation. Why not try it tonight and see for yourself! We hope you’ll find as much joy in cooking and eating it as we do. Share your thoughts, substitutions, or tips in the comments below. Happy cooking!
Print
Zesty Lemon White Bean Orzo Soup
- Total Time: 40 minutes
- Yield: 6 servings 1x
Description
This Zesty Lemon White Bean Orzo Soup is a vibrant and comforting dish perfect for any day.
Ingredients
- 1 can cannellini beans, rinsed and drained
- ¾ cup dry orzo pasta
- 1 small onion, finely chopped
- 2 small carrots, chopped
- 2 celery stalks, diced
- 6 garlic cloves, minced
- 5 cups low-sodium vegetable broth
- 2 tbsp coconut milk or vegan butter
- Juice and zest of 1 lemon
- 1 tsp dried thyme
- ½ tsp Italian seasoning
- ½ tsp red pepper flakes (optional)
- 2 bay leaves
- 1 sprig fresh rosemary (or ½ tsp dried)
- 1 tsp olive oil
- Salt and pepper, to taste
- ¼ cup fresh parsley, chopped (for garnish)
Instructions
- In your pot, warm up the olive oil over medium heat. Introduce the finely chopped onion, diced carrots, and celery with just a sprinkle of salt to enhance their natural flavors. Let these vegetables sauté for about 5 to 7 minutes, stirring occasionally, until they become soft and slightly translucent.
- Add the minced garlic into the pot, stirring quickly to prevent burning. As it begins to release its aroma (around 1 minute), incorporate the dried thyme, Italian seasoning, and, if using, the red pepper flakes.
- Next, stir in the drained cannellini beans followed by your choice of coconut milk or vegan butter.
- Pour in the vegetable broth, ensuring the beans are submerged. Add the bay leaves and fresh rosemary, then bring to a rolling boil. Once boiling, reduce the heat and let it simmer for about 10 minutes.
- Carefully add the orzo to your soup, stirring occasionally to prevent sticking and simmer for another 10 to 12 minutes.
- Turn off the heat and stir in the lemon juice and zest. Adjust with salt and pepper to suit your taste.
- Serve your soup hot, ladeling it into bowls and garnishing generously with fresh parsley.
Notes
Opt for high-quality vegetable broth to enhance the soup’s depth of flavor. If storing leftovers, you may need to add extra broth when reheating as the orzo tends to absorb liquid over time.
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Category: Soup
Nutrition
- Calories: 220 kcal
- Sodium: 400 mg
- Protein: 9 g